N.C. Gen. Stat. § 160A-19
Leases

A city is authorized to lease as lessee, with or without option to purchase, any real or personal property for any authorized public purpose. A lease of personal property with an option to purchase is subject to Article 8 of Chapter 143 of the General Statutes.

History
(1973, c. 426, s. 9.)
